What are Whole Numbers?

Whole numbers are a set of non-negative integers that start from zero and continue infinitely. These numbers do not include fractions, decimals, or negative values. The first five whole numbers are:

0,1,2,3,40, 1, 2, 3, 4

Formula to Calculate the Mean

The mean of a set of numbers is calculated using the formula:

Mean=Sum of all numbersTotal number of values\text{Mean} = \frac{\text{Sum of all numbers}}{\text{Total number of values}}

This formula ensures that we obtain the central value of the given data set.

Step-by-Step Calculation of the Mean

Step 1: Find the Sum of the First Five Whole Numbers

The first five whole numbers are 0, 1, 2, 3, and 4.
Adding these values together:

0+1+2+3+4=100 + 1 + 2 + 3 + 4 = 10

Thus, the sum of the first five whole numbers is 10.

Step 2: Count the Total Number of Values

Since we are considering five whole numbers, the total count (n) is:

n=5n = 5

Step 3: Apply the Mean Formula

Now, substituting the values into the mean formula:

Mean=105=2\text{Mean} = \frac{10}{5} = 2

Additional Insights

  • The mean is affected by extreme values (outliers). In large datasets, a few very high or very low numbers can shift the mean significantly.
  • For datasets with an even spread of numbers, the mean provides an accurate central measure.

The mean of the first five whole numbers (0, 1, 2, 3, and 4) is 2. Understanding how to calculate the mean helps in analyzing numerical data effectively and is widely applied in various fields.
